Output 50d38d21f3904436e84c8ccc7d322254d73e746c3f93983fecd98829be0c7e1d:20

value
491344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64aa58f5627eed287fae6223332059bfac12ecd0 OP_EQUAL
address
3AsHZgHhrcWiyWpHK39mSNhmBo5rzovJyn
transaction
50d38d21f3904436e84c8ccc7d322254d73e746c3f93983fecd98829be0c7e1d
confirmations
298315
spent
true